Carpentry Repair vs. Replacement in Orlando, FL

Situation Recommendation Rationale
Door frame separated at one corner from humidity cycling Repair Re-gluing, clamping, and shimming restores square geometry and keeps the original frame intact.
Base trim cracked along a single wall run after floor settling Repair Scarf-splicing and repainting the affected run costs far less than full strip-out, and drywall services on the adjacent wall stay undisturbed.
Custom shelving unit with sagging center shelf under load Repair Adding a center support bracket or sister board corrects the sag without full rebuild.
Hollow-core commercial door with puncture damage at mid-panel Replace Hollow-core panels cannot be structurally patched; a new solid-core slab provides better durability for high-traffic commercial entries.
Exterior door frame with soft wood from prolonged moisture exposure Replace Soft or punky wood holds no fastener load; full frame replacement with primed composite stops the moisture pathway and pairs with exterior painting services to seal the new unit.
Built-in storage with one damaged shelf panel in a larger system Repair Replacing the single panel and refinishing to match preserves the full unit at a fraction of full replacement cost.
Stair railing with multiple loose balusters and corroded hardware Replace Corroded fasteners compromise the entire rail assembly; full baluster and hardware replacement restores code-compliant security, and floor services can address any tread wear at the same visit.
Casework with warped face frames across the full cabinet run Replace Warping across a full run signals moisture saturation inside the cabinet box; piecemeal repair will not hold, and full casework replacement paired with painting services yields a lasting result.

Common Carpentry Challenges in Orlando, FL Commercial Spaces

Orlando's warm humid climate and active storm season create recurring carpentry problems in commercial facilities, from swollen frames after summer downpours to UV-degraded exterior trim along sun-exposed facades.

Humidity-Swollen Door Frames

Year-round humidity averaging 74% causes wood door frames to swell and bind, making closure difficult and damaging hardware. Door services address the root cause by re-squaring and shimming the frame rather than just adjusting the strike.

UV-Degraded Exterior Trim

High UV exposure at Orlando's low latitude breaks down exterior trim coatings rapidly, especially on west-facing facades in areas like College Park and Lake Eola Heights. Siding services paired with trim replacement stop the degradation cycle before substrate damage sets in.

Storm-Damaged Fence Sections

Tropical storm and hurricane activity near Orlando International Airport and Lake Apopka sends debris through commercial property fencing every season. Fence services reset posts and replace damaged boards after each significant weather event to restore perimeter security.

Deteriorating Deck and Landing Surfaces

Commercial outdoor decks and loading dock landings in Hunter's Creek and Conway absorb heavy rain and foot traffic that accelerate wood breakdown. Deck services replace rotted decking, reinforce post bases, and restore the structure to a safe working surface.

Clogged Gutter and Fascia Damage

Daily summer thunderstorms overwhelm gutters that run along wood fascia, and standing water accelerates fascia rot on buildings throughout Audubon Park and SoDo. Gutter services clear debris and restore flow while carpentry repairs or replaces the compromised fascia board.

Garage Door Frame Separation

Commercial garages in Thornton Park and MetroWest experience frame separation when sandy soils shift during Orlando's dry-to-wet seasonal transitions. Garage services include frame realignment and blocking installation to stabilize the opening and prevent further movement.
